GUR Claims Responsibility for Moscow Blast Killing Two Police Officers

#TverskoyDistrict, #Russia
Ukraine's military intelligence agency, GUR, claimed responsibility for a Moscow bombing that killed two police officers and a civilian on Wednesday. The blast on Yeletskaya Street occurred just two days after a car bomb killed Fanil Sarvarov, a high-ranking general responsible for training forces.
